48 more. The Hive is a fun and safe place to hangout with friends and play fun games, and we take every effort to make it that way. Enter a Hive command that maps a table in the Hive application to the data in DynamoDB. If building Hive source using Maven (mvn), we will refer to the directory "/packaging/target/apache-hive-{version}-SNAPSHOT-bin/apache-hive-{version}-SNAPSHOT-bin" as
for the rest of the page. To view the purposes they believe they have legitimate interest for, or to object to this data processing use the vendor list link below. start | Microsoft Learn Hive - Start HiveServer2 and Beeline - Spark By {Examples} while loop. ZooKeeper Getting Started Guide - The Apache Software Foundation By default, tables are assumed to be of text input format and the delimiters are assumed to be ^A(ctrl-a). * to 'hive'@'localhost' identified by'changeme'; . at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) Hives are itchy skin rash that affects most people on a daily basis. The Hive DML operations are documented in Hive Data Manipulation Language. Run sql script from command line with username and password jobs Its a JDBC client that is based on the SQLLine CLI. Here is the error-message at the stdout: Is it possible that the smoke-test is flawed? If possible, avoid scratching the hives to avoid making them worse. 2021 Cloudera, Inc. All rights reserved. Do I need a thermal expansion tank if I already have a pressure tank? The compiler has the ability to transform information in the backend. The name of the log entry is "HiveMetaStore.audit". Run Scala code with spark-submit. Hive compiler generates map-reduce jobs for most queries. Is it plausible for constructed languages to be used to affect thought and control or mold people towards desired outcomes? How to react to a students panic attack in an oral exam? Making statements based on opinion; back them up with references or personal experience. How to show that an expression of a finite type must be one of the finitely many possible values? This can cause unexpected behavior/errors while running in local mode. Method 1: Starting Postgres Server Using "net start" Launch the Windows CMD as an administrator and execute the "net start" command to start the Postgres Server: net start postgresql-x64-15. How to Create a Table in Hive - Knowledge Base by phoenixNAP Jupyter-notebook server. Hive Metastore Configuration - Hadoop Online Tutorials (ConnectionImpl.java:792) Cloudera does not currently support using the Thrift HTTP protocol to connect Beeline to HiveServer2 (meaning that you cannot set hive.server2.transport.mode=http). This will start the Hive terminal, which can be used to issue HiveQL commands. If you want to learn more about Hadoop Hive, you can learn more by going to the website below. Hive Shell is the default service for interacting with Hive, which is just Hive Shell. Senior Hadoop developer with 4 years of experience in designing and architecture solutions for the Big Data domain and has been involved with several complex engagements. Create a database named "company" by running the create command: The terminal prints a confirmation message and the time needed to perform the action. Use HiveQL to query and manage your Hadoop distributed storage and perform SQL-like tasks. at java.sql.DriverManager.getConnection(DriverManager.java:582) Using it on Windows would require slightly different steps. lists all the table that end with 's'. Travis is a programmer who writes about programming and delivers related news to readers. By default, it's set to zero, in which case Hive lets Hadoop determine the default memory limits of the child jvm. container.appendChild(ins); The hive should be in a sunny location and away from any trees or shrubs. Is it a bug? All release versions are in branches named "branch-0.#" or "branch-1.#"or the upcoming "branch-2.#", with the exception of release 0.8.1 which is in "branch-0.8-r2". 'LOCAL' signifies that the input file is on the local file system. {"serverDuration": 85, "requestCorrelationId": "2f8c89d8c5300836"}, https://git-wip-us.apache.org/repos/asf/hive.git, https://logging.apache.org/log4j/2.x/manual/async.html, http://java.sun.com/javase/6/docs/api/java/util/regex/Pattern.html. log4j.logger.org.apache.hadoop.hive.ql.log.PerfLogger=DEBUG. $ $HIVE_HOME/bin/schematool -dbType <db type> -initSchema HiveServer2 (introduced in Hive 0.11) has its own CLI called Beeline. Save my name, email, and website in this browser for the next time I comment. Hive client. 08:46 AM (JDBC4Connection.java:49) There is no Password for the user hive! If you have mild hives, they will usually go away on their own after a few hours. Customer-organized groups that meet online and in-person. Start hive CLI (command line interface) service with $ hive command on terminal after starting start-dfs.sh daemons we should get hive shell open without any error messages as shown below. How to restart HiveServer2 from the command line - Cloudera mysql> grant all on *. What Is the Difference Between 'Man' And 'Son of Man' in Num 23:19? Every command can be used now but they have to be entered with a '#' at the beginning. Clouderas new Model Registry is available in Tech Preview to connect development and operations workflows, [ANNOUNCE] CDP Private Cloud Base 7.1.7 Service Pack 2 Released, [ANNOUNCE] CDP Private Cloud Data Services 1.5.0 Released. Let's connect to hiveserver2 now. Without the -v option only the variables that differ from the base Hadoop configuration are displayed. To stop a hive, you will need to remove the queen bee and the worker bees from the hive box. hadoop - Starting hiveserver2 - Stack Overflow Most of the entries in the NAME column of the output from lsof +D /tmp do not begin with /tmp. Evaluate Confluence today. The most common combination in the corporate environment lately is Java using the Spring Framework for the server and React for the client. If the user wishes, the logs can be emitted to the console by adding the arguments shown below: Alternatively, the user can change the logging level only by using: Another option for logging is TimeBasedRollingPolicy (applicable for Hive 1.1.0and above, HIVE-9001) by providing DAILY option as shown below: Note that setting hive.root.logger via the 'set' command does not change logging properties since they are determined at initialization time. The difference between the phonemes /p/ and /b/ in Japanese. The Hive query operations are documented in Select. When using local mode (using mapreduce.framework.name=local), Hadoop/Hive execution logs are produced on the client machine itself. at java.lang.reflect.Constructor.newInstance(Constructor.java:513) Start a Cloud Shell instance: Go to Cloud Shell In Cloud Shell, set the default Compute Engine zone to the zone where you are going to create your Dataproc clusters. Use the following commands to start beeline and connect to a running HiveServer2 process. At the command prompt for the current master node, type hive. To confirm that HiveServer2 is working, start the beeline CLI and use it to execute a SHOW TABLES query on the HiveServer2 If enabled, Hive analyzes the size of each map-reduce job in a query and may run it locally if the following thresholds are satisfied: So for queries over small data sets, or for queries with multiple map-reduce jobs where the input to subsequent jobs is substantially smaller (because of reduction/filtering in the prior job), jobs may be run locally. Hive What is Metastore and Data Warehouse Location? More about RegexSerDe can be found here in HIVE-662 and HIVE-1719. HiveServer2 also starts a Jetty Http server on port 1002 which provides you with Web UI. Note:Normal server stop includes a quiesce stage before the server is shutdown. Is a collection of years plural or singular? at java.sql.DriverManager.getConnection(DriverManager.java:154) - edited Command Line Interface Presto 0.279 Documentation var slotId = 'div-gpt-ad-sparkbyexamples_com-box-3-0'; Several of the most memorable games from the past are being re-released, and the team has been hard at work on a project to do so. Hive uses log4j for logging. Usage (as it is in Hive 0.9.0) usage: hive. By default logs are not emitted to the console by the CLI. As of 0.13, Hive is built using Apache Maven.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. More games are available here. This doesn't log anything to STDOUTPUT but starts a process which is running, however I can't see any tcp sockets listening on the port 10000. Once connected to Hive, you can use the 'create' command to create tables, databases and other elements. It is well-maintained. 2021 Cloudera, Inc. All rights reserved. Hive command is a data warehouse infrastructure tool that sits on top Hadoop to summarize Big data. The value of the replication data, the namenode path, and the datanode path of your local file systems are all contained within the hdfs-site.xml file. I can't find any db name in my hive-site.xml . This can be useful in a wide range of situations, including machine learning and predictive modeling. The HiveCLI (deprecated) and Beeline command 'SET' can be used to set any Hadoop (or Hive) configuration variable. localhost at port 10000: If you are using HiveServer2 on a cluster that does not have Kerberos security enabled, then the password is arbitrary in the command for starting Beeline. No new updates from Will Hive have been released in quite some time, but this doesnt mean the game is not still in the works. Note that because of concurrency and security issues, HiveServer1 was deprecated in CDH 5.3 and has been removed from CDH 6. After starting the Hive shell as the hive user, you can submit queries to Hive. It is logged at the INFO level of log4j, so you need to make sure that the logging at the INFO level is enabled (see. The frames will need to be placed in the hive box last. Why Hive Table is loading with NULL values? export PROJECT=$ (gcloud info. Table names can be changed and columns can be added or replaced: Note that REPLACE COLUMNS replaces all existing columns and only changes the table's schema, not the data. About an argument in Famine, Affluence and Morality, Styling contours by colour and by line thickness in QGIS, Topological invariance of rational Pontrjagin classes for non-compact spaces. To do so, right-click on the offline registry you want to edit > click New > Key. Make sure the directory has the sticky bit set (chmod 1777 ). The files contain the port number, the memory allocated for the file system, and the size of the Read/Write buffers. If you're using Amazon EMR release version 5.7 or earlier, download the PostgreSQL JDBC driver. There are fewer games. You may find it useful, though it's not necessary, to set HIVE_HOME: To use the Hive command line interface (CLI) from the shell: Starting from Hive 2.1, we need to run the schematool command below as an initialization step.